Harmony expands Papua New Guinea exploration portfolio
Johannesburg. Thursday, 27 August 2009. Harmony Gold Mining Company Limited
(Harmony) is pleased to advise that it has acquired two new exploration
projects, the Amanab and the Mt Hagen Projects, in Papua New Guinea (PNG).
These exploration licenses (EL) complement the exploration activities
undertaken by Harmony and underscore the company's commitment and belief in the
developing minerals industry in PNG.
Amanab Project EL1708
Amanab project EL1708 was granted on 6 July 2009 and comprises of about 863
square kilometres of tenure. The tenement is located approximately 160km north
of the OK Tedi copper-gold mine in the Sandaun Province and was pegged to
target the bedrock source of the alluvial goldfield centered on the Yup River.
Mt Hagen Project EL1611 & EL1596
The Mt Hagen project comprises two contiguous tenements encompassing
approximately 1100 square kilometres of tenure. The tenements are located
approximately 20km north-northeast of Mt Hagen and are readily accessible via
the Highlands Highway connecting Lae and Porgera.
Harmony acquired 100% of the mineral rights for EL1596 from Frontier Resources
for the cash consideration of A$300,000.
Harmony also acquired the rights to explore the adjacent tenement EL1611 over a
four year period, with the condition that Harmony's exploration program meets
the minimum annual expenditure commitment. At any time during this period
Harmony may exercise an option to purchase 100% of the tenement for a total
cash consideration of 6 million Kina.
